Word Search – Word Searches

A “word search puzzle” is a game that can be enjoyed by both children and adults. A word search is a grid of letters where you are supposed to find the hidden words in the grid. Generally, you can find these words up, down, diagonally and even backwards in such directions.

Advanced Word Searches

Advanced word search puzzles tend to include longer words, which are hidden in much larger word grids. Also, the incidence of words that are diagonal and spelled backwards are much higher, which increases the difficulty level of the puzzle dramatically.

Word Searches For Children

A childrens word search puzzle is going to involve shorter words like “dog”, “cat” and “ball” and mostly consist of words either up-and-down or crossways. The word grids on childrens’ word searches tend to be much smaller, so the child gains a sense of accomplishment while brushing up on their spelling skills and vocabulary.

Some restaurants will pass out word searches for children eating at the restaurant, to pass the time until the meal is served.
